In such an atmosphere a fire or explosion is feasible when 3 basic problems are met. This is usually described as the "harmful area" or "combustion" triangular. In order to secure installations from a potential explosion an approach of analysing and classifying a possibly dangerous area is called for. The function of this is to guarantee the right option and installment of equipment to inevitably protect against a surge and to make certain security of life.(https://profiles.delphiforums.com/n/pfx/profile.aspx?webtag=dfpprofile000&userId=1891249800)
No devices ought to be installed where the surface area temperature level of the equipment is greater than the ignition temperature level of the offered danger. Below are some usual dust unsafe and their minimum ignition temperature. Coal Dust 380C 225C Polythene 420C (melts) Methyl Cellulose 420C 320C Starch 460C 435C Flour 490C 340C Sugar 490C 460C Grain Dust 510C 300C Phenolic Material 530C > 450C Aluminium 590C > 450C PVC 700C > 450C Residue 810C 570C The chance of the threat existing in a focus high adequate to cause an ignition will differ from location to location.
In order to classify this risk an installment is separated right into areas of risk relying on the amount of time the harmful is present. These areas are referred to as Zones. For gases and vapours and dusts and fibres there are 3 zones. In regards to explosive risk, an unsafe area is an environment in which an explosive atmosphere is present (or might be expected to be present) in amounts that need special precautions for the building and construction, installation and usage of equipment. eeha. In this post we explore the difficulties encountered in the office, the threat control actions, and the required competencies to function securely
It is an effect of modern life that we manufacture, keep or manage a variety of gases or liquids that are regarded combustible, and a range of dusts that are considered flammable. These compounds can, in specific problems, develop eruptive environments and these can have significant and terrible consequences. The majority of us are familiar with the fire triangle eliminate any kind of one of the three elements and the fire can not happen, yet what does this mean in the context of unsafe locations? When damaging this down right into its simplest terms it is basically: a mix of a particular amount of release or leakage of a specific compound or material, blending with ambient oxygen, and the visibility of a resource of ignition.
In most circumstances, we can do little concerning the degrees of oxygen in the air, yet we can have substantial impact on sources of ignition, for instance electric devices. Hazardous areas are documented on the harmful location classification illustration and are determined on-site by the triangular "EX-SPOUSE" sign. Here, amongst other key information, zones are divided right into 3 types depending on the danger, the probability and period that an eruptive ambience will exist; Area 0 or 20 is regarded the most hazardous and Area 2 or 22 is regarded the least.
